TLDR The Ethereum Foundation deployed 3,400 ETH into Morpho Vaults to expand its on-chain treasury strategy. The allocation includes 1,000 ETH directed into Morpho Vaults V2. The deployment is valued at approximately $7.6 million at current market prices. The foundation previously deployed 2,400 ETH and $6 million in stablecoins into Morpho in October 2025. The Ethereum Foundation committed up to 50,000 ETH to DeFi platforms earlier in 2025. The Ethereum Foundation deployed 3,400 ETH into Morpho Vaults on Wednesday, expanding its on-chain treasury strategy. Bitcoin [BTC] faced sustained bearish pressure, with the downtrend holding since its October 2025 peaks. Amid this prolonged downtrend, Bitcoin long-term holders saw their positions go from extreme profitability to deep losses.  As a result, some long-term holders capitulated and closed their positions at a loss. However, with prolonged loss-selling, it seems long-term holders are exhausted.  Bitcoin LTH activity hit bear market levels Despite continued market weakness, Bitcoin long-term holders have significantly reduced spending. Analysts at research and brokerage firm Bernstein said bitcoin is developing a more resilient ownership structure as institutional capital flows through exchange-traded funds and corporate treasury strategies reshape the market. In a Monday note to clients, the analysts led by Gautam Chhugani said BTC has held up well during the recent Middle East conflict, outperforming traditional assets such as gold and global equity indices. Bitcoin rose roughly 7% last week, while Ethereum climbed about 9%, according to the report.
